This qualifies as yet another childish movie with a predictable story line.  I saw this movie while traveling in Europe.  I was bored and had nothing else to do. I am sorry that I did.

 

Jennifer Garner plays Gray, a young girl who has lost her fiancé on the eve of their wedding day. 

Luckily for her she has several friends she can rely on.  One is a fat slob, Sam played by Kevin Smith, who is constantly eating and boozing.  Then there is Dennis (Sam Jaeger), a nice guy who has had a secret crush on her for the last six years. Then there is Fritz (Timothy Olyphant), a seedy character who was her fiancé’s best friend.  The guy is so slimy that he has sex with a girl during the funeral in, of all the places, Gray’s bathroom while Gray is hiding behind the shower curtain.

She soon discovers that her dead fiancé was a very rich man and was secretly supporting a secret son by a masseuse, Maureen played by Juliette Lewis.  Initially, she hates her dead fiancé for cheating on her and shuns the girl friend.  That is until she meets the little boy who maybe autistic and feels sorry for him and tries to have him declared the legitimate heir of her fiancé.  She also comes to term with her own sexuality by admitting that she had a relationship with another girl.

Along the way, she sleeps with the sleazy Fritz and falls in love with him because he is so bad!  In the end, the young boy gets the money, even though DNA tests prove that he was not really the dead fiancé’s offspring, Dennis the nice guy moves out, Gray moves in with Fritz and Maureen the masseuse moves in with the sloppy messy Sam. 

Hollywood pays money for some strange movies. This was another one with no real plot.   There was no real acting in this movie other than by Juliette Lewis as what I’d call a near-whore with a heart of gold.  Susannah Grant wrote and directed this piece of trash.

The movie has strong sexual content.  I was surprised that they actually showed it on the plane.
